How they compare
Singapore currently reports 29.25 % change on previous year against 27.7 % change on previous year in Cameroon, a difference of 1.55 % change on previous year.
That makes Singapore's figure about 1.1 times Cameroon's.
The two have swapped places 11 times across 23 shared years of data; in 2002 it was Cameroon ahead.
Cameroon ranks 47th and Singapore ranks 46th of 210 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Cameroon averaged higher in 2 and Singapore in 1.

About this data
The year-on-year percentage change in Other paper and paperboard, not elsewhere specified — Import value.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
